Lance Reddick Voiced Hellboy in Upcoming Game


Actor Lance Reddick passed away recently and left his mark on many shows such as Yarn and movies like John Wick and its three sequels. However, he is also known for his video game roles, such as Zavala Fate 2 and Inside my lap Horizon series. However, there is at least one more game planned for him in which he plays the main role: Hellboy Web of Wyrd.

Hellboy creator Mike Mignola tweeted about it in response to the actor’s untimely death, noting that Reddick was “such a nice guy.” He recalled meeting him a few weeks earlier when Reddick was set to voice Hellboy “for a new computer game.”

Although he doesn’t say it outright, he’s talking about a third-person roguelite Hellboy Web of Wyrdwhich was revealed at The Game Awards in December 2022. Reddick can clearly be heard saying just three words in the reveal trailer – “Me? I’m angry,” but developer Upstream Arcade didn’t promote Reddick’s involvement at the time.

However, the game’s Twitter account did Retweet a tweet from Dark Horse Comics offered condolences to the Reddick family, then released a statement saying, “Our hearts go out to Lance’s family, friends, colleagues and fans. Lance was a great performer, generous with his time and attention—he had an unparalleled talent, and we continue to be honored to have him Our Hellboy.
